A Guide To Choosing Chandelier Diameter Sizes
A room 10' x 10', a 17" to 20" diameter chandelier.
A room 12' x 12', a 26" or 27" chandelier.
A room 14' x 14', choose a 24" to 36" chandelier.
Chandeliers should be about 12" narrower than the width of the table over which it hangs.
Another way some people size chandeliers, is to add the room sizes together.
Sample, 10 foot x 12 foot room ( 10 + 12 = 22 ) so a chandelier around 22" dia. may look great.
Rooms with high ceilings, you can add up to six inches or more to the width of the chandelier.
A room 24' x 24' with a high ceiling, = could take a large 48" to 54" dia. chandelier.
Chandelier Heights
Chandeliers should hang at least 30" to 36" from the surface of the table.
Most tables are 30" high plus another 30" = 60" or 5 feet, floor to bottom of chandelier.
On ceilings more that 8 feet high you may want to add about 3" more to the floor to chandelier height, for every added foot in ceiling height.
A 9 foot ceiling, the chandelier may look better at about 63" floor to bottom of chandelier. on 10 foot about 66" high.
In a living room, hall or entryway the chandelier should hang 7 feet or more above the floor.
